
Jason McElwain, the author of the book, The Game of My Life, was born with autism. He didn't talk until he was five years old. He had few social skills and didn't make friends easily. In high school, he found his love - basketball. However, Jason was too short to make the team because he was only 5 feet 6 inches tall. He became the team manager instead of playing. He took care of the equipment and made sure the players had everything they needed such as towels and water bottles. Jason did his job happily.
In February 2006, during Jason's last year of high school, the coach decided to give Jason a chance to actually play in the game. It was the last home game of the season and there were only four minutes left in the game.
